導航:首頁 > 操作系統 > android收藏功能實現

android收藏功能實現

發布時間:2022-09-19 18:50:32

⑴ 安卓版百度文庫怎麼收藏

點開圖標,進入到網路文庫的歡迎頁面。初次進入的時候,歡迎頁面的載入時間有一點長,約為5秒鍾。(以後每次的載入時間約為2秒鍾)可以看到,歡迎頁面的風格非常的簡約,這似乎跟網路「簡單可依賴」的核心文化相交融。進入到網路文庫,首先引入眼簾的是網路文庫給新手們貼心准備的功能簡介。根據功能簡介,用戶們就能大概了解網路文庫的主要功能了。

閱讀完貼心的功能簡介,小編首先對網路文庫的在線功能進行了體驗。大家都知道,網路文庫在PC端是非常強大的。在PC端的網路文庫,用戶可以在線閱讀和下載涉及課件,習題,考試題庫,論文報告,專業資料,各類公文模板。當然,網路文庫手機客戶端也是同樣給力。網路文庫客戶端已經完全做到了與PC端無縫連接,用戶通過客戶端就可以下載各種不同領域的文庫文件。

網路文庫擁有4個在線頻道:特別推薦、下載排行、分類瀏覽以及個人中心。
網路文庫還支持全文庫搜索,用戶想看什麼,只要輕松一搜,就能輕松實現。小編試著搜索了法律,可以看到,所有與法律相關的書籍都出現在了搜索結果中。進入到書籍詳細頁,用戶可以將書籍加入收藏,或直接選擇在線閱讀。

除了強大的在線查找、閱讀功能,網路文庫還支持本地書籍的閱讀。用戶只要將書籍拷貝到[06idsFQQur]內的/books文件夾中,就能在網路文庫的「所有書籍」中找到。網路文庫支持html、txt、umd、epub等格式書籍的閱讀。添加好書籍之後,重新打開一次網路文庫,就能在所有書籍頻道看到最新添加的書籍了。

點開自己想要閱讀的書籍,進入到閱讀頁面, 用戶可以進行:查看書籍目錄、添加書簽、快速翻頁、鎖定屏幕方向、修改屏幕亮度以及字體大小等功能設置。除了諸多的閱讀功能設置之外,網路文庫的擁有超炫的手勢3D翻書效果,是android平台最頂級的翻頁效果。

OK,終於體驗完了網路文庫的所有功能了。最後,按照慣例,我們來檢測一下網路文庫在使用時所消耗的手機內存大小,以及是否綠色安全吧。可以看到,網路文庫的使用內存為45.12M,算是中等偏上的數值。不過,手機閱讀軟體的使用內存向來都不會很低,相信45.12M對於很多Android用戶來說都是可以接受的。另外,安全掃描顯示網路文庫是完全綠色安全的。
參考資料網路文庫Android版 http://2265.com/soft_11/21/android_397.html

⑵ android軟體如何實現收藏功能

代碼沒有,但實現思路可以這樣來:用代碼實現拍照程序,將圖片保存在sd卡,然後將保存路徑加入資料庫中。用戶在瀏覽圖片時可讀取資料庫中的圖片路徑得到Bitmap,通過gallery顯示出來。

⑶ 安卓手機有哪些隱藏功能,怎麼弄

安卓手機主要有十大隱藏功能,看看你平時注意到沒. 1、截屏很容易 每台Android設備的截屏都不同,但多數非常簡單。Galaxy S III:同時按返回鍵和開關鍵;Galaxy Nexus:同時按開關鍵和調低音量鍵;HTC One X、S和V:同時按返回鍵和開關鍵;Droid Razr MAXX:同時按住開關鍵和調低音量鍵3秒鍾,直到聽到攝像頭發出咔嚓聲。 2、選擇偏愛的聯系人 如果不是最新版Android系統(Jellybean),在主屏上添加聯系人就很方便。長按屏幕的空白處,但彈出菜單時選擇快捷鍵-聯系人,然後拉滾動條選擇你要添加的聯系人,點擊該聯系人就會在屏幕上顯示。 如果是最新版Android手機系統,需要點擊菜單按鈕,在右上角選擇軟體圖標,滑過一個頁面選擇聯系人,然後會提示選擇特定聯系人。 3、阻止應用程序自動出現在主屏上 有時主屏出現新應用程序會很方便,但有時用戶不想顯示。這時可以去谷歌Play店關閉該功能,選擇菜單然後選擇設置,最後放棄「自動添加圖標」,軟體快捷鍵就不會自動顯示在主屏上。 4、邊拍視頻邊拍照 這也很容易,只要點擊屏幕,照片就會存儲在圖片庫中,但不是所有Android手機都有這個功能,但多數新型號都能做到。 5、將Android手機設備作為便攜USB驅動盤使用 通過USB線將手機連接到電腦,可以激活Android的存儲模式,USB模式可以在電腦和手機之間傳輸文件,這是在路上獲取文件的很好方式。 6、將Android手機設備作為便攜USB驅動盤使用 通過USB線將手機連接到電腦,可以激活Android的存儲模式,USB模式可以在電腦和手機之間傳輸文件,這是在路上獲取文件的很好方式。 7、監控數據流量使用情況 如果制定了流量計劃,實時了解用了多少流量非常重要。Android內置了監控軟體,可以方便了解收藏的應用程序流量使用情況。從設置開始,然後在屏幕上方選擇流量使用,一旦進入後就可以准確知道哪個應用程序使用的流量最多,這個數據可以存儲,並按月查詢。 8、從鎖屏中訪問通知 無需解鎖屏幕就可瀏覽通知,只要將手指從屏幕上方滑動到下方,點擊一個應用就可立即打開。 9、集成谷歌語音可以不必總是使用真正的電話號碼 如果沒有安裝谷歌語音(Google Voice)應用,就去Play店下載一個。只要願意,谷歌語音可以提供語音郵件功能,代替運營商的服務,該功能可以在手機和電腦上接收語音郵件。谷歌語音還可以利用一些方便的功能,如向特定聯系人發送特定的語音祝賀郵件。所有這些功能都可以在谷歌語音中使用。 10、使用谷歌音樂 谷歌音樂真正快速增長?該服務讓用戶無線享受音樂。谷歌音樂可讓用戶在雲中免費存儲最?2萬首歌曲,用戶可在任何設備上欣賞音樂,包括台式機。訪問自己的歌曲和購買歌曲非常容易。谷歌音樂會預安裝在很多新Android設備上,但如果不是新設備,也可以去Play店免費下載。

⑷ android 上通過微信分享怎麼實現

第三方sdk

⑸ qq音樂android版沒有網路收藏功能

親測有的,從網上下個最新版本的qq音樂(大概2.4M),裡面有個雲端收藏功能,登陸後就可以查看之前電腦qq音樂收藏的歌曲了,在樂庫或者電台裡面聽到好聽的歌曲可以選擇下載到本地,然後我的音樂-本地歌曲裡面點擊前面的紅心,就可以把歌曲同步到電腦qq音樂裡面去了

⑹ 求助安卓大神:關於用eclipse實現收藏夾功能

一般都是安卓客戶端 +php伺服器, android客戶端和php+mysql+apache搭建的伺服器之間的簡單交互的例子:


先在mysql裡面建一個testlogin的資料庫,裡面有一個users表,記錄了id,用戶名和密碼。

在php的虛擬目錄下新建個php項目,創建conn.php和login.php文件。剛學點php寫的不好。
conn.php是連接mysql資料庫的。代碼如下:

<?php
$dbhost="localhost:3306";
$dbuser="root";//我的用戶名
$dbpass="";//我的密碼
$dbname="testlogin";//我的mysql庫名
$cn=mysql_connect($dbhost,$dbuser,$dbpass)ordie("connecterror");
@mysql_select_db($dbname)ordie("dberror");
mysql_query("setnames'UTF-8'");
?>login.php代碼:<?php
include("conn.php");//連接資料庫
$username=str_replace("","",$_POST['name']);//接收客戶端發來的username;
$sql="select*fromuserswherename='$username'";
$query=mysql_query($sql);
$rs=mysql_fetch_array($query);if(is_array($rs)){
if($_POST['pwd']==$rs['password']){
echo"loginsucceed";
}else{
echo"error";
}
}
?>

php代碼寫的很爛,伺服器算是架設完了。。

android客戶端:
布局隨意寫一下就這樣吧:

下面是主要的代碼:

java">{
@Override
publicvoidrun(){
//TODOAuto-generatedmethodstub
//getusernameandpassword;
userName=user_name.getText().toString().trim();
password=pass_word.getText().toString().trim();
//連接到伺服器的地址,我監聽的是8080埠
StringconnectURL="http://192.168.1.100:8080/text0/com.light.text/login.php/";
//填入用戶名密碼和連接地址
booleanisLoginSucceed=gotoLogin(userName,password,connectURL);
//判斷返回值是否為true,若是的話就跳到主頁。
if(isLoginSucceed){
Intentintent=newIntent();
intent.setClass(getApplicationContext(),HomeActivity.class);
startActivity(intent);
proDialog.dismiss();
}else{
proDialog.dismiss();
//Toast.makeText(ClientActivity.this,"登入錯誤",Toast.LENGTH_LONG).show();
System.out.println("登入錯誤");
}
}
}//登入的方法,傳入用戶密碼和連接地址
privatebooleangotoLogin(StringuserName,Stringpassword,StringconnectUrl){
Stringresult=null;//用來取得返回的String;
booleanisLoginSucceed=false;
//test
System.out.println("username:"+userName);
System.out.println("password:"+password);
//發送post請求
HttpPosthttpRequest=newHttpPost(connectUrl);
//Post運作傳送變數必須用NameValuePair[]陣列儲存
Listparams=newArrayList();
params.add(newBasicNameValuePair("name",userName));
params.add(newBasicNameValuePair("pwd",password));
try{
//發出HTTP請求
httpRequest.setEntity(newUrlEncodedFormEntity(params,HTTP.UTF_8));
//取得HTTPresponse
HttpResponsehttpResponse=newDefaultHttpClient().execute(httpRequest);
//若狀態碼為200則請求成功,取到返回數據
if(httpResponse.getStatusLine().getStatusCode()==200){
//取出字元串
result=EntityUtils.toString(httpResponse.getEntity());
ystem.out.println("result="+result);
}
}catch(Exceptione){
e.printStackTrace();
}
//判斷返回的數據是否為php中成功登入是輸出的
if(result.equals("loginsucceed")){
isLoginSucceed=true;
}
returnisLoginSucceed;
}

android客戶端和php+mysql+apache搭建的伺服器之間的簡單交互,實現登入功能。
實現原理就是android客戶端發送請求,傳給伺服器登入的用戶名密碼,伺服器收到這些,連接到資料庫查詢,如果用戶名和密碼匹配正確,就輸出字元串返回給客戶端。

伺服器端:
先在mysql裡面建一個testlogin的資料庫,裡面有一個users表,記錄了id,用戶名和密碼。

在php的虛擬目錄下新建個php項目,創建conn.php和login.php文件。剛學點php寫的不好。
conn.php是連接mysql資料庫的。代碼如下:


<?php

$dbhost = "localhost:3306";

$dbuser = "root"; //我的用戶名

$dbpass = ""; //我的密碼

$dbname = "testlogin"; //我的mysql庫名

$cn = mysql_connect($dbhost,$dbuser,$dbpass) or die("connect error");

@mysql_select_db($dbname)or die("db error");

mysql_query("set names 'UTF-8'");

?>login.php代碼:<?php

include ("conn.php");//連接資料庫

$username=str_replace(" ","",$_POST['name']);//接收客戶端發來的username;

$sql="select * from users where name='$username'";

$query=mysql_query($sql);

$rs = mysql_fetch_array($query);if(is_array($rs)){

if($_POST['pwd']==$rs['password']){

echo "login succeed";

}else{

echo "error";

}

}

?>

復制代碼



php代碼寫的很爛,伺服器算是架設完了。。

android客戶端:
布局隨意寫一下就這樣吧:

下面是主要的代碼:

class LoginHandler implements Runnable {

@Override

public void run() {

// TODO Auto-generated method stub

//get username and password;

userName = user_name.getText().toString().trim();

password = pass_word.getText().toString().trim();

//連接到伺服器的地址,我監聽的是8080埠

String connectURL="http://192.168.1.100:8080/text0/com.light.text/login.php/";

//填入用戶名密碼和連接地址

boolean isLoginSucceed = gotoLogin(userName, password,connectURL);

//判斷返回值是否為true,若是的話就跳到主頁。

if(isLoginSucceed){

Intent intent = new Intent();

intent.setClass(getApplicationContext(), HomeActivity.class);

startActivity(intent);

proDialog.dismiss();

}else{

proDialog.dismiss();

// Toast.makeText(ClientActivity.this, "登入錯誤", Toast.LENGTH_LONG).show();

System.out.println("登入錯誤");

}

}

}//登入的方法,傳入用戶 密碼 和連接地址

private boolean gotoLogin(String userName, String password,String connectUrl) {

String result = null; //用來取得返回的String;

boolean isLoginSucceed = false;

//test

System.out.println("username:"+userName);

System.out.println("password:"+password);

//發送post請求

HttpPost httpRequest = new HttpPost(connectUrl);

//Post運作傳送變數必須用NameValuePair[]陣列儲存

List params = new ArrayList();

params.add(new BasicNameValuePair("name",userName));

params.add(new BasicNameValuePair("pwd",password));

try{

//發出HTTP請求

httpRequest.setEntity(new UrlEncodedFormEntity(params,HTTP.UTF_8));

//取得HTTP response

HttpResponse httpResponse=new DefaultHttpClient().execute(httpRequest);

//若狀態碼為200則請求成功,取到返回數據

if(httpResponse.getStatusLine().getStatusCode()==200){

//取出字元串

result=EntityUtils.toString(httpResponse.getEntity());

ystem.out.println("result= "+result);

}

}catch(Exception e){

e.printStackTrace();

}

//判斷返回的數據是否為php中成功登入是輸出的

if(result.equals("login succeed")){

isLoginSucceed = true;

}

return isLoginSucceed;

}


登入成功後會跳到主頁:

代碼就這樣多,實現的最簡單的登入方法,其實還有很多要實現的,需要為用戶保存用戶名和密碼及登入成功後或者不成功後的反饋等。

⑺ android 新聞資訊類app的收藏功能是怎麼實現的

微信作為面向大眾的產品,它的界面一直保持簡潔的風格,實現布板的主界面時也參考了很多APP的設計,最終決定採用類似於微信的主界面,即四個tab滑動。
google了一把之後,找到了一款滑動利器PagerSlidingTabStrip。

⑻ Android studio怎麼文件添加到收藏和打開收藏夾

1首先需要打開Android studio編寫代碼的工具,並進行導入Android的項目之後,可以找到項目需要做收藏內容,已項目mainactivity文件為例,選中該文件。

2右鍵選中的activity的文件,彈出的下拉的菜單中進行選中「add to favorites」的選項。

3彈出到下一級的菜單中,my application為收藏過的內容,需要添加為收藏內容,選中add to new favorites list即可。

4彈出了一個為add new favorites list的選項框中,對添加的收藏夾的昵稱,可以根據需要命名昵稱,繼續點擊ok。

5文件收藏成功之後,就可以進行查看收藏夾中內容,點擊左下角位置中的favorites的按鈕。

6進入到收藏夾中,找到命名的昵稱文件夾,在該文件夾內可以剛才添加的文件。查看該文件內容信息,可以直接雙擊即可。

閱讀全文

與android收藏功能實現相關的資料

熱點內容
android平滑滾動效果 瀏覽:841
什麼是編譯器指令 瀏覽:219
微控制器邏輯命令使用什麼匯流排 瀏覽:885
程序員在學校里是學什麼的 瀏覽:601
oraclejava數據類型 瀏覽:890
程序員考注冊會計師 瀏覽:957
怎麼使用access的命令按鈕 瀏覽:899
有點錢app在哪裡下載 瀏覽:832
博途v15解壓後無法安裝 瀏覽:205
什麼是根伺服器主機 瀏覽:438
安卓手游怎麼申請退款 瀏覽:555
安卓系統如何分享網頁 瀏覽:278
ad如何編譯pcb工程 瀏覽:414
除了滴滴app哪裡還能用滴滴 瀏覽:399
截圖怎麼保存文件夾然後壓縮 瀏覽:8
幻影伺服器怎麼樣 瀏覽:28
具體哪些廣東公司招程序員 瀏覽:870
嵌入式編譯器教程 瀏覽:307
ssl數據加密傳輸 瀏覽:87
51單片機定時器方式2 瀏覽:332